diff options
author | 2015-11-02 14:34:06 -0800 | |
---|---|---|
committer | 2015-11-02 14:34:06 -0800 | |
commit | 5fe7f0c7f513c5f9ea115178b97b7d045d030912 (patch) | |
tree | f1b9630950e902328485315e2a4b95824ac6d513 | |
parent | 39e8fc783a0bd1c0449b159a55ff34c56f89f8f1 (diff) | |
download | meta-oic-5fe7f0c7f513c5f9ea115178b97b7d045d030912.tar.gz |
Recipe for the OICSensorBoard application
* Added recipe with packaged source code for the
OICSensorBoard application.
* Application description and set-up guidelines are in
https://wiki.iotivity.org/_media/oicsensorboardreadme.pdf
Signed-off-by: Kishen Maloor <kishen.maloor@intel.com>
-rw-r--r-- | recipes-apps/iotivity-sensorboard/files/iotivity-sensorboard.tar.gz | bin | 0 -> 4879 bytes | |||
-rw-r--r-- | recipes-apps/iotivity-sensorboard/iotivity-sensorboard_1.0.0.bb | 25 |
2 files changed, 25 insertions, 0 deletions
diff --git a/recipes-apps/iotivity-sensorboard/files/iotivity-sensorboard.tar.gz b/recipes-apps/iotivity-sensorboard/files/iotivity-sensorboard.tar.gz Binary files differnew file mode 100644 index 0000000..f89f3be --- /dev/null +++ b/recipes-apps/iotivity-sensorboard/files/iotivity-sensorboard.tar.gz diff --git a/recipes-apps/iotivity-sensorboard/iotivity-sensorboard_1.0.0.bb b/recipes-apps/iotivity-sensorboard/iotivity-sensorboard_1.0.0.bb new file mode 100644 index 0000000..71518bd --- /dev/null +++ b/recipes-apps/iotivity-sensorboard/iotivity-sensorboard_1.0.0.bb @@ -0,0 +1,25 @@ +SUMMARY = "Iotivity SensorBoard" +DESCRIPTION = "Iotivity Server application for Edison which demonstrates Iotivity server capabilities through the integration of an add-on breadboard that hosts temperature, ambient light and LED resources" +HOMEPAGE = "https://www.iotivity.org/" +DEPENDS = "iotivity mraa" +SECTION = "apps" +LICENSE = "Apache-2.0" +LIC_FILES_CHKSUM = "file://server.cpp;beginline=1;endline=19;md5=a692dd0c72bcfa341a4ba826b37caf15" + +SRC_URI = "file://iotivity-sensorboard.tar.gz \ + " + +S = "${WORKDIR}/iotivity-sensorboard" + +IOTIVITY_BIN_DIR = "/opt/iotivity" +IOTIVITY_BIN_DIR_D = "${D}${IOTIVITY_BIN_DIR}" + +do_install() { + install -d ${IOTIVITY_BIN_DIR_D}/apps/iotivity-sensorboard + install -c -m 555 ${S}/sensorboard ${IOTIVITY_BIN_DIR_D}/apps/iotivity-sensorboard +} + +FILES_${PN} = "${IOTIVITY_BIN_DIR}/apps/iotivity-sensorboard/sensorboard" +FILES_${PN}-dbg = "${IOTIVITY_BIN_DIR}/apps/iotivity-sensorboard/.debug" +RDEPENDS_${PN} += "iotivity-resource mraa" +BBCLASSEXTEND = "native nativesdk" |